There must be something about 7 August - perhaps it being the date when traditionally judges clear their desks before the holidays - because it was on 7 August 2018 I found myself in exactly the same position as Tomb and others in terms of waiting: Luigi confirmed on 26 August that the court had granted my application and we managed to cut the appeal period by intimating to the Government. Much turns on the approach of your comune after judgment is received but just to give an indication on timings I had my birth certificate in hand the week before Christmas 2018 and I received my passport in February 2019.

All, - just a quick update.

Our first hearing took place on 01/17 and the Judge did not issue a judgment because one of the documents lacked an Apostle. The judge set a new hearing for May 29th. Luigi sent me the document back, I got the Apostle, mailed it back to him and he has filed it with Court again. The hearing for our second group took place in February. So, now the judge will make the final decision for both cases in May 29th .

Luigi apologized for the oversight, but it was also my fault as I knew all documents have to have the Apostle. It’s OK though! - after waiting so many years for a hearing, waiting few more months is nothing.
